Tropical Getaways: Hawaii, Florida Keys, Puerto Rico offer warm beaches and lush landscapes for November honeymoons
November is an ideal month for couples seeking a tropical honeymoon in the USA, as destinations like Hawaii, the Florida Keys, and Puerto Rico offer warm beaches and lush landscapes without the peak season crowds. These locales provide a perfect blend of relaxation, adventure, and romance, ensuring newlyweds can create unforgettable memories.
Hawaii: A Paradise of Diversity
Hawaii’s islands cater to every honeymoon style. Maui’s Road to Hana offers a scenic drive through rainforests and waterfalls, while Oahu’s Waikiki Beach is perfect for couples who want a mix of luxury resorts and vibrant nightlife. For seclusion, Kauai’s Na Pali Coast provides dramatic cliffs and pristine beaches. November’s weather is ideal, with temperatures in the mid-70s to 80s°F, and fewer tourists compared to winter months. Pro tip: Book a helicopter tour over the Big Island’s volcanoes for a once-in-a-lifetime experience.
Florida Keys: Laid-Back Island Charm
The Florida Keys are a string of islands offering a relaxed, beachside vibe. Key West’s Duval Street is lined with quaint shops and lively bars, while the Dry Tortugas National Park provides snorkeling and historic Fort Jefferson. November’s temperatures hover around 80°F, making it perfect for water activities like kayaking or paddleboarding. For a romantic touch, charter a sunset sail or stay in an overwater bungalow at Little Palm Island Resort. Caution: Avoid overpacking—the Keys’ casual atmosphere calls for light, breezy attire.
Puerto Rico: Caribbean Vibes Without the Passport
Puerto Rico combines tropical beauty with rich culture. Old San Juan’s cobblestone streets and colorful colonial buildings offer a charming backdrop for photos, while El Yunque Rainforest provides hiking trails to waterfalls. November is part of the dry season, with temperatures in the mid-80s°F, ideal for exploring bioluminescent bays like Mosquito Bay in Vieques. Practical tip: Rent a car to explore hidden gems like Playa Flamenco in Culebra, one of the Caribbean’s most beautiful beaches.
Comparing the Three: Which Fits Your Honeymoon Style?
Hawaii is best for couples seeking diverse landscapes and luxury resorts, but it’s the priciest option. The Florida Keys offer a laid-back, budget-friendly escape with a focus on water activities and island hopping. Puerto Rico stands out for its cultural richness and affordability, though it may require more planning due to language and transportation logistics. Regardless of choice, November’s warm weather and fewer tourists make these destinations ideal for a tropical honeymoon.

Mountain Retreats: Aspen, Jackson Hole, Lake Tahoe provide cozy cabins, skiing, and stunning winter scenery
November in the USA is a magical time for honeymoons, especially for couples seeking the tranquility and adventure of mountain retreats. Aspen, Jackson Hole, and Lake Tahoe emerge as top destinations, offering a blend of cozy cabins, world-class skiing, and breathtaking winter scenery. These locales are not just about the snow; they’re about creating unforgettable moments in settings that feel both grand and intimate.
Analytical Insight: What sets these mountain retreats apart is their ability to cater to diverse honeymoon preferences. Aspen, with its upscale vibe, combines luxury lodging and gourmet dining with access to four ski mountains. Jackson Hole, on the other hand, appeals to couples seeking rugged adventure, with its steep slopes and proximity to Grand Teton National Park. Lake Tahoe offers a unique blend of alpine and lakeside charm, where couples can ski in the morning and enjoy a sunset cruise in the afternoon. Each destination balances relaxation and excitement, making them ideal for newlyweds looking to start their journey together on a high note.
Practical Tips: To make the most of your mountain honeymoon, plan ahead. November marks the beginning of ski season, so book your cabin and lift tickets early. Aspen’s St. Regis and Jackson Hole’s Amangani are renowned for their honeymoon packages, often including couples’ massages and private dinners. For a more budget-friendly option, Lake Tahoe’s Airbnb cabins offer privacy and stunning views without breaking the bank. Pack layers—temperatures can drop significantly, especially at higher elevations. Don’t forget to bring a good camera; the snow-capped peaks and golden aspen trees create picture-perfect backdrops.

City Escapes: New York City, San Francisco, Charleston blend romance, culture, and vibrant nightlife in November
November in the USA offers a unique opportunity for honeymooners seeking a blend of romance, culture, and vibrant nightlife. For those who thrive in urban settings, New York City, San Francisco, and Charleston emerge as top contenders, each offering a distinct flavor of city escapism.
Consider New York City as the quintessential urban romance. November transforms the city into a cozy, festive wonderland with holiday markets, ice skating rinks, and twinkling lights. Start your days with a stroll through Central Park, where the fall foliage creates a picturesque backdrop for intimate moments. Evenings can be spent savoring Michelin-starred cuisine or catching a Broadway show. For a touch of adventure, take a helicopter tour over Manhattan’s skyline. Pro tip: Book tickets for *The Nutcracker* at Lincoln Center for a timeless, romantic experience.
In contrast, San Francisco offers a more laid-back yet equally enchanting city escape. November’s mild weather is perfect for exploring iconic landmarks like the Golden Gate Bridge or wandering through the colorful streets of Chinatown. The city’s cultural diversity shines in its culinary scene—think dim sum in the morning and fresh seafood at Fisherman’s Wharf for dinner. For nightlife, head to the Mission District for craft cocktails and live music. Don’t miss a sunset ferry ride to Sausalito for breathtaking views of the bay.
Charleston, South Carolina, brings Southern charm to the forefront. Its historic architecture, cobblestone streets, and horse-drawn carriages create an intimate, storybook atmosphere. November’s cooler temperatures make it ideal for exploring the city’s plantations and gardens, such as Magnolia Plantation, where you can enjoy a private picnic. The city’s culinary scene is a highlight, with Lowcountry cuisine like shrimp and grits or she-crab soup. For a romantic evening, take a ghost tour or enjoy a jazz performance in one of the city’s historic venues.
Each of these cities offers a unique blend of experiences tailored to November’s charm. New York dazzles with its grandeur, San Francisco captivates with its eclectic vibe, and Charleston enchants with its timeless elegance. Whether you’re sipping hot cocoa in Bryant Park, sipping wine in Napa Valley, or sipping sweet tea on a Charleston porch, these city escapes promise unforgettable honeymoon memories.
Practical tip: Pack layers for varying temperatures, especially in San Francisco’s microclimates, and book accommodations in central locations to maximize your time exploring. November’s off-peak travel season often means better deals on flights and hotels, making these destinations both romantic and budget-friendly.

Desert Oases: Sedona, Palm Springs, Santa Fe offer mild weather, scenic hikes, and relaxing resorts
November in the USA is an ideal time to explore the desert oases of Sedona, Palm Springs, and Santa Fe. These destinations offer a unique blend of mild weather, breathtaking landscapes, and luxurious relaxation, making them perfect for honeymooners seeking both adventure and tranquility. While coastal destinations may face chilly temperatures, these desert towns boast daytime highs in the 60s to 70s°F, ensuring comfortable outdoor exploration without the summer heat.
Sedona, Arizona, stands out for its spiritual energy and iconic red rock formations. Couples can embark on scenic hikes like the Cathedral Rock Trail, a moderate 1.2-mile round trip offering panoramic views of the surrounding canyons. For a more relaxed experience, the Amitabha Stupa & Peace Park provides a serene setting for meditation and reflection. After a day of exploration, unwind at one of Sedona’s spa resorts, such as the Enchantment Resort, which offers couples massages and private stargazing experiences. Pro tip: Pack layers, as temperatures can drop significantly in the evening.
Palm Springs, California, is a mid-century modern oasis surrounded by the Coachella Valley’s rugged beauty. Honeymooners can hike the Indian Canyons, where palm-lined oases and waterfalls create a stark contrast to the arid landscape. For a touch of luxury, stay at the Parker Palm Springs, known for its whimsical design and secluded gardens. Don’t miss the aerial tramway, which ascends to 8,500 feet for stunning mountain views. Caution: Avoid hiking during midday heat; start early or opt for late afternoon treks.
Santa Fe, New Mexico, combines desert charm with rich cultural heritage. The city’s mild November weather is perfect for exploring its adobe architecture and world-class art galleries. Hike the Dale Ball Trails for views of the Sangre de Cristo Mountains, or take a short drive to Bandelier National Monument for ancient cliff dwellings. For relaxation, Ten Thousand Waves offers Japanese-style hot tubs and spa treatments inspired by traditional practices. Practical tip: Book accommodations in the historic downtown area to stay close to restaurants and cultural attractions.
Comparatively, while all three destinations offer mild weather and scenic hikes, each has a distinct personality. Sedona appeals to those seeking spiritual renewal, Palm Springs caters to design enthusiasts and luxury seekers, and Santa Fe immerses couples in Southwestern culture. Regardless of choice, these desert oases promise unforgettable honeymoon experiences, blending adventure with relaxation in some of the USA’s most captivating landscapes.

Wine Country: Napa Valley, Sonoma, Willamette Valley feature vineyard tours, gourmet dining, and romantic retreats
November in the USA offers a unique opportunity for honeymooners to immerse themselves in the charm of Wine Country, where the crisp autumn air complements the rich flavors of the season. Napa Valley, Sonoma, and Willamette Valley stand out as premier destinations, each offering a distinct blend of vineyard tours, gourmet dining, and romantic retreats. These regions are particularly enchanting in November, as the harvest season winds down, leaving behind a landscape of golden vineyards and a sense of tranquility that’s perfect for newlyweds.
For those seeking a curated experience, Napa Valley is the epitome of luxury and sophistication. Start your journey with a private vineyard tour at iconic estates like Castello di Amorosa or Opus One, where you can learn about the winemaking process and sample exclusive vintages. Pair your tastings with a gourmet picnic amidst the vines or opt for a multi-course meal at Michelin-starred restaurants like The French Laundry or SingleThread. To elevate the romance, book a stay at Auberge du Soleil, known for its breathtaking views and couples’ spa treatments. Pro tip: Reserve tastings and dining experiences well in advance, as November is a popular time for wine enthusiasts.
Sonoma, often overshadowed by its neighbor Napa, offers a more laid-back yet equally captivating experience. Its diverse microclimates produce a wide range of wines, from robust Zinfandels to elegant Pinot Noirs. Explore the Sonoma Plaza, a historic town square surrounded by boutique shops and cozy cafes, or venture to the Russian River Valley for a serene escape. For a truly romantic retreat, consider the Honor Mansion, a boutique hotel with private cottages, fireplaces, and a daily wine hour. Don’t miss the opportunity to dine at Farm at Carneros, where farm-to-table cuisine pairs perfectly with local wines. Sonoma’s charm lies in its authenticity—it’s a place where you can unwind and connect without the pretense.
Willamette Valley in Oregon is a hidden gem for honeymooners who prefer a quieter, more intimate setting. Known for its world-class Pinot Noir, this region offers a rustic yet refined experience. Begin with a tour of Domaine Drouhin or Eyrie Vineyards, pioneers of Oregon’s wine industry. For dining, The Painted Lady in Newberg serves a seasonal tasting menu that showcases local ingredients. Stay at The Allison Inn & Spa, a luxurious retreat with expansive vineyard views and a spa that specializes in wine-inspired treatments. Willamette Valley’s cooler November weather makes it ideal for cozy evenings by the fire, sipping on a glass of Pinot Noir and savoring the moment.
To make the most of your Wine Country honeymoon, consider a few practical tips. First, plan your itinerary around the activities you both enjoy most—whether it’s wine tasting, hiking, or simply relaxing. Second, pack layers, as November temperatures can vary, especially in Willamette Valley. Finally, embrace the slower pace of the off-season; many wineries offer more personalized experiences without the crowds. Whether you choose Napa’s opulence, Sonoma’s charm, or Willamette’s serenity, Wine Country promises a honeymoon filled with unforgettable moments and the perfect blend of romance and indulgence.
